N-doped carbon fibers derived from porous wood fibers encapsulated in a zeolitic imidazolate framework as an electrode material for supercapacitors

HIGHLIGHTS

  • who: Zhen Zhang and collaborators from the Resources, College of Materials Science and, Central South University of and Technology, Changsha, China have published the article: N-Doped Carbon Fibers Derived from Porous Wood Fibers Encapsulated in a Zeolitic Imidazolate Framework as an Electrode Material for Supercapacitors, in the Journal: Molecules 2023, 28, x FOR PEER REVIEW of /2023/
  • what: The authors provide a method for preparing supercapacitor electrode materials using zeolitic imidazolate framework-8 (ZIF-8)-coated wood fibers. This work provides an efficient way to synthesize hierarchically porous N-doped carbon materials for high . . .
